Rather than a survey of any one aspect or period of
American history, literature, or popular culture, this course is an
introduction to the interdisciplinary field of American Studies, a field
defined both by the range of texts we read (essays, novels, autobiographies,
photographs, films, music, architecture, historical documents, legal texts),
and by the questions we ask of them.
Those questions include: How have different Americans imagined what it
means to be an American? What ideas
about national history, patriotism, and moral character shape their visions of
Americanness? How do they draw the
boundaries that define who belongs within the nation and who gets
excluded? What uses have been made of
the claim to an American identity, and what is at stake in that claim? How have Americans imagined a national
landscape, a national culture, and to what ends? The course will drive toward a consideration of the place that
September 11 has begun to assume in American cultural memory. On-line
